OpenCL+VS2015+WIN10(Nvidia GPU) 配置
一、下载与安装:
在Windows下使用需要OpenCL,需要相应的配置,并与主机所使用的GPU有关,在此介绍使用Nvidia GPU为主机的OpenCL的配置。
下载:CUDA Toolkit 8.0
按照相应的操作步骤选择符合主机的信息,并选择exe(local)安装包。
安装下载好的安装包。
二、配置:
第一步:设置附加包含目录
属性 -> C/C++ -> 常规 -> 附加包含目录
添加:drive:\path\NVIDIA GPU Computing Toolkit\CUDA\v8.0\include
例如在作者本机上其目录为:C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v8.0\include
第二步:设置附加库目录
属性 -> 连接器 -> 常规 -> 附加库目录
添加:drive:\path\NVIDIA GPU Computing Toolkit\CUDA\v8.0\lib\x64
或者:drive:\path\NVIDIA GPU Computing Toolkit\CUDA\v8.0\lib\Win32(视解决方案平台决定)
例如在作者本机上其目录为:C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v8.0\lib\x64
第三步:设置附加依赖项
属性 -> 连接器 -> 输入 -> 附加依赖项
添加:OpenCL.lib
打开编译器在代码文件中#include <CL/cl.h>
就能使用OpenCL了。